Israel and Iran Trade Off New Strikes Across the Region as Hostilities Intensify

Israel and Iran carried out new rounds of military operations across several parts of the Middle East as tensions between the long time rivals continued to rise. The escalating confrontation has drawn global attention as governments and international organizations warn that continued violence could expand into a broader regional crisis. Security officials say air defense systems in multiple countries have remained active as missiles and aerial drones continue to be launched across borders.

Israeli authorities confirmed that their forces conducted additional military operations targeting sites believed to be connected to Iranian military infrastructure. Iranian officials also reported launching new waves of projectiles toward Israeli territory in response. Residents in several cities reported hearing loud explosions overnight as defense systems attempted to intercept incoming threats. The continued exce of strikes has kept millions of civilians on edge throughout the region.

The widening confrontation has also affected neighboring countries that fear the violence could spill beyond the immediate rivals. Governments across the Gulf and the eastern Mediterranean have raised alert levels for their security forces. Regional airspace has faced temporary closures in some areas while commercial airlines continue to review flight routes to avoid potential danger zones.

Military analysts say the ongoing confrontation reflects years of mounting tensions between the two countries. The current phase of hostilities appears to involve more direct and sustained operations than previous confrontations. Experts warn that the longer the violence continues the greater the possibility that additional regional actors could become involved, potentially transforming the situation into a wider Middle East conflict.

Diplomatic efforts are underway as international leaders urge restraint from all sides. Several governments and global institutions have called for immediate dialogue aimed at reducing tensions and preventing further escalation. However, with both sides continuing to launch military operations and showing little sign of stepping back, observers say the situation remains highly unle and unpredictable.
